The jet stream brought in this African dust from the Sahara and it has been in the air over our area for the past three weeks. I would bet there has been way more people go to the emergency rooms and clinics with respiratory problems than the virus.
This stuff gets in the eyes, nose and ears. No rain and 100 + degree temps. has not helped.
We had this happen two years ago but I cannot remember how long it lingered on.
